Maria Kannegaard’s Hey Ya

This instrumental version of OutKast’s “Hey Ya” is a great example of the jazz process of taking popular tunes and reinventing them with instrumental vision and prowess. Think Coltrane playing “My Favorite Things.”

It’s similar to what we are aspiring to do with Poetry DNA. Instead of having a computer audio program extract the musical DNA from the voice, however, the jazz musician relies simply on musical talent. 🙂
